Arystanbek Dyussenov
62138aaa5a Python part of multidim. array support for RNA complete.
Multidim. arrays can now be modified at any level, for example:

struc.arrayprop = x
struc.arrayprop[i] = x
struc.arrayprop[i][j] = x
struc.arrayprop[i][j][k] = x
etc...

Approriate rvalue type/length checking is done. 

To ensure all works correctly, I wrote automated tests in release/test/rna_array.py.

These tests cover: array/item access, assignment on different levels, tests that proper exceptions are thrown on invalid item access/assignment.

The tests use properties of the RNA Test struct defined in rna_test.c. This struct is only compiled when building with BF_UNIT_TEST=1 scons arg.

Currently unit tests are run manually by loading the script in the Text Editor.
Here's the output I have: http://www.pasteall.org/7644

Things to improve here:
- better exception messages when multidim. array assignment fails. Those we have currently are not very useful for multidim.
- add tests for slice assignment

Brecht Van Lommel
7df35db1b1 2.5
Notifiers
---------

Various fixes for wrong use of notifiers, and some new notifiers
to make things a bit more clear and consistent, with two notable
changes:

* Geometry changes are now done with NC_GEOM, rather than
  NC_OBJECT|ND_GEOM_, so an object does need to be available.
* Space data now use NC_SPACE|ND_SPACE_*, instead of data
  notifiers or even NC_WINDOW in some cases. Note that NC_SPACE
  should only be used for notifying about changes in space data,
  we don't want to go back to allqueue(REDRAW..).

Depsgraph
---------

The dependency graph now has a different flush call:

DAG_object_flush_update(scene, ob, flag)
is replaced by:
DAG_id_flush_update(id, flag)

It still works basically the same, one difference is that it now
also accepts object data (e.g. Mesh), again to avoid requiring an
Object to be available. Other ID types will simply do nothing at
the moment.

Docs
----

I made some guidelines for how/when to do which kinds of updates
and notifiers. I can't specify totally exact how to make these
decisions, but these are basically the guidelines I use. So, new
and updated docs are here:

http://wiki.blender.org/index.php/BlenderDev/Blender2.5/NotifiersUpdates
http://wiki.blender.org/index.php/BlenderDev/Blender2.5/DataNotifiers

Joshua Leung
a819ef1bf2 2.5 - Keyframing Bugfixes + Code Cleanups
* DopeSheet + Graph Editor - 'Sample Keyframes' option now tags newly created keyframes as being breakdowns. Also moved reduced the code duplication here by moving the core code for this to the animation module.

* Keyframing (Standard/Auto) - Added proper 'replace' option
Keyframes can now be rekeyed non-destructively when the INSERTKEY_REPLACE flag is provided to the keyframing API functions, since this option will make sure that only the values of the handles get altered.

For the Auto-Keyframing 'Replace/Edit Keys' option, this means that it truly works as it describes now, since it will now only replace the values of the keyframes on the current frame, and won't create new keyframes in the process or destroy the tangents already created for those keys.

For things like the sliders in animation editors, keyframes changing the value won't destroy existing tangents.

Joshua Leung
fa01703ac3 2.5 - Keyframe Types for DopeSheet
It is now possible to tag certain keyframes as being 'breakdowns' in the DopeSheet. Breakdown keyframes are drawn as slightly smaller blue diamonds.

Simply select the relevant keyframes and use the RKEY hotkey (or from the menus, Key->Keyframe Type) to choose between tagging the keyframe as a 'proper' keyframe and a 'breakdown' keyframe. 

Notes:
* Please note that this feature does not currently imply anything about breakdowns moving around keyframes or behaving any differently from any other type of keyframe
* In future, if there is any such need, more keyframe types could be added, though this is not really likely at all
